Absalom's Tomb: A Historical Landmark in Jerusalem This evocative image captures the solemnity and mystery of Absalom's Tomb, a historic site located in Jerusalem. Absalom, the third son of King David, is a significant figure in the rich tapestry of Israel's history. Known for his striking beauty and charm, Absalom rebelled against his father's rule, leading a rebellion that ultimately ended in his tragic death. The story of Absalom's rebellion is recounted in the Second Book of Samuel in the Hebrew Bible. After years of growing discontent with his father's rule, Absalom gained the support of the Israelite army and fled Jerusalem to gather allies. The rebellion reached its climax at the Battle of Ephraim, where Absalom's forces were defeated, and he was killed in the heat of battle. According to tradition, Absalom's body was brought back to Jerusalem and buried in this tomb, located in the Kidron Valley. The exact identity of the tomb's occupant is a subject of debate among scholars, but its historical significance is undeniable.
